Oat Vetch Hay 93813

Echuca, VIC
420 tonnes available

Vetch oats blend hay in 8x4x3 bales stacked in a well maintained shed with good access. Cut with windrower. Cured in difficult conditions over 40 days with rain and cool weather. Some variability with amount of vetch and oats in bales. Some staining and internal blackspot. Average moisture of 12.7%

Vetch Oaten hay in 8x4x3 bales. Difficult curing conditions. Some Rye grass present. Average moisture 12.7%
